The SANbloc S50 has been tested and found to comply with the limits for a Class “A” digital device, pursuant to part 15 of the FCC Rules. These limits are designed to provide reasonable protection against harmful interference when the equipment is operated in a commercial environment. This equipment generates, uses, and can radiate radio frequency energy and, if not installed and used in accordance with the instruction manual, may cause interference to radio communications. Operation of this equipment in a residential area is likely to cause harmful interference, in which case the user will be required to correct the interference at their own expense.

Changes or modifications not expressly approved by Adaptec could void the user’s authority to operate the equipment.

Safety Precautions

Note The maximum current draw is printed on the label on the back of the storage subsystem.

Caution Before touching any enclosure components, ground yourself and take antistatic precautions. Adaptec recommends that you use an antistatic wrist strap and a grounding wire as minimum precautions.

Environmental Conditions — Make sure the conditions of the environment in which the server resides fall within the specifications for your model.

Installing the Server — During installation, make sure the server is always placed on a surface capable of supporting its weight.
